I've been working on building some parts for a model kit I'm working on of the GB Ecto-1. Mainly I'm trying to create all the computer stuff in the back. I'm trying ot make it as accurate as possible to the actual movie used car. What I've been doing is modeling all the consoles and pieces in tS7.6 and then I plan to print those peices up at Shapeways and then use them in the actual model kit. So far it's been going pretty well. But I still haven't printed any test pieces yet. I'm working on a build log as I progress on SMA... but here's the idea I've got so far.
Been getting alot of help from the Ghostbusters Fans as well (they know just about everything there is to know about the Ecto because most of them built the real things!) Lemme know what you guys think!

Try making a cylinder to use as an SDS control mesh. Move edge rings in point edit mode to shape it. Side and top views are good for that. Then smooth with SDS. Credit to Spacekdet for that idea.
In TS 7.6 with model side when you make a primitive there are useful controls available. Just after you click to place a primitive right click on the primitive icon to get these controls. You can change the number of sides, rounding, number of loops and rings, etc. You can make a nice cylinder with enough rings without unnecessary extra edges.

The SDS control mesh with a cylinder, I have to try that out.
In the MS of TS you can make curves, move them around like nurbs curves, save it into a path library and then use that curve as a path extrude, then you just need to rotate and scale the path it will extrude along. You also may need to right click on the tool, after extruding, and toggle the "follow/normal" option (if I remember correctly) or else the loops will not follow the curve and all orientate a single direction.

But you can make a path using the path animation tool in the animation toolbar in MS. Once you have the path, you can save it as a curve or path in the library toolbar. Another way of making a path is doing an extrude, saving that as a path or curve, or even making a curve and saving that as a path or curve.
Once you have that, you can then select path-extrude then select a path/curve, or vice versa, don't remember, and it should work! Then you may need to scale and rotate before hitting the path extrude again, the once it extrudes, right click on it and make sure "bend" with the curve is activated, or else all the control planes will extrude in one direction, not with the curve.
